Now I'm relatively new to CSS and SVG for that matter, but from a 
consistency / usability of UI purpose I'm particular interested in the 
flexibility of these icons. Some of these appear to be "more flexible" than 
others, and maybe that'd be a useful distinction to add to the site. What I 
mean by that is the "parameterized" values in the SVG. For example if I 
search for bell, I get a couple of options:

There's bootstrap's bell ($:/images/bootstrap/bell)

And then there's tabler's bell ($:/images/tabler-icons/bell) - perhaps my 
favorite library so far
<svg width="22pt" height="22pt" class="tc-image-tbi-bell tc-image-button" 
viewBox="0 0 24 24" stroke-width="2" stroke="currentColor" fill="none" 
stroke-linecap="round" stroke-linejoin="round"><path stroke="none" d="M0 
0h24v24H0z" fill="none"/><path d="M10 5a2 2 0 0 1 4 0a7 7 0 0 1 4 6v3a4 4 0 
0 0 2 3h-16a4 4 0 0 0 2 -3v-3a7 7 0 0 1 4 -6" /><path d="M9 17v1a3 3 0 0 0 
6 0v-1" /></svg>

The cool part here is that in the tabler set, I can go in and change the 
stroke-width with a text reference like {{$:/custom/ui/icons!!stroke}}, do 
that for all the icons and play around with a global setting. I don't know 
if there's a CSS way to do that also, but I think that's really cool.
